After years of seeing the world in absolutes, he has taught me how to pick out all the shades of possibilities.

In the book "Perfect Match" by Jodi Picoult, a significant theme revolves around the journey of understanding and navigating the complexities of life. The protagonist learns to move beyond a rigid, black-and-white perspective, embracing the various shades of gray that exist in human experiences and choices. This growth reflects a deeper awareness of possibilities and the complexities involved in moral and ethical dilemmas.

The quote encapsulates this transformation, highlighting the shift from a simplistic worldview to one that acknowledges nuance and ambiguity. It emphasizes the importance of recognizing that life often presents intricate scenarios where multiple outcomes are possible, encouraging a more thoughtful and empathetic approach to decision-making.
